Conservatives made a movie, and not only is it compelling and funny, but it's doing relatively well at the box office.

Am I Racist?, a film starring Matt Walsh of The Daily Wire, produced by his employer, came in fifth at the box office this past weekend. It made $4.7 million on a $3 million budget, meaning it's well on its way to being a commercial success. (Movies typically need to make 2.5 times their budget at the box office to turn a profit.)

The Republican U.S. Senate nominee in Massachusetts this year is embracing a moderate approach in his challenge to U.S. Senator Elizabeth Warren (D-Cambridge).

John Deaton, a 57-year-old attorney from Swansea, is running a socially liberal and fiscally conservative candidate, taking a different approach from that of many other Republicans running for U.S. Senate across the country.
